Transaction 33c063b59d73e2ae69c76878c65517e7a4bee295511526f34dbd2d2bd220b103
1 Input
1 Output
-
33c063b59d73e2ae69c76878c65517e7a4bee295511526f34dbd2d2bd220b103:0
- value
- 1502313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4587f4a092e96220172d9c0cdefb74a800e20b89 OP_EQUAL
- address
- 382fR91vJJ8eg579AvFbQFsYm1oPdKrR3a